Difference between revisions of "Template:VALT Server Migration"
IVSWikiBlue (talk | contribs) (→On the Old Server) |
IVSWikiBlue (talk | contribs) |
||
Line 6: | Line 6: | ||
<div class="floating_card"><font color="orange">'''Note: ''It is beneficial to stop the apache service on the old server to prevent further recording of videos on it'''''</font> </div> | <div class="floating_card"><font color="orange">'''Note: ''It is beneficial to stop the apache service on the old server to prevent further recording of videos on it'''''</font> </div> | ||
<br> | <br> | ||
+ | <div class="section"> | ||
# Disable the Apache web service on the server to prevent further recordings | # Disable the Apache web service on the server to prevent further recordings | ||
− | #: < | + | #: <code>sudo service apache2 stop</code> |
# Disable the restart Wowza cronjob: | # Disable the restart Wowza cronjob: | ||
#: - Type in the following command: | #: - Type in the following command: | ||
− | #: < | + | #: <code>crontab -e</code> |
− | #: - Press {{Keyboard | key = 1}} to continue< | + | #: - Press {{Keyboard | key = 1}} to continue |
+ | </div> | ||
+ | |||
+ | |||
#:{{img | file = Edit_Cronjobs_Command.png}}<br> | #:{{img | file = Edit_Cronjobs_Command.png}}<br> | ||
#:<br> - Comment out the following job: <div class="floating_card"><pre>0 3 * * * /usr/local/valt/bin/restartwowza</pre></div><br> | #:<br> - Comment out the following job: <div class="floating_card"><pre>0 3 * * * /usr/local/valt/bin/restartwowza</pre></div><br> |
Revision as of 15:11, 2 August 2022
Note: Change IP's in the below commands to match the IP's of the new and old server
On the Old Server
Note: It is beneficial to stop the apache service on the old server to prevent further recording of videos on it
- Disable the Apache web service on the server to prevent further recordings
-
sudo service apache2 stop
-
- Disable the restart Wowza cronjob:
- - Type in the following command:
-
crontab -e
- - Press 1 to continue
- Type in the following, then press Enter Enter:
sudo chmod 777 -R /usr/local/WowzaStreamingEngine/content/
- Type in the following, then press Enter Enter:
mysqldump -uivsadmin -p valt
- Enter in the mysql password
- Type in the following, then press Enter:
scp valt.sql ivsadmin@NewServerIP:/home/ivsadmin/
- Enter password for ivsadmin.
On the New Server
- Type in the following, then press Enter:
mysql -uivsadmin -p valt
- Type in the password to MySQL.
- Type:
DROP database valt;
- Type:
CREATE database valt;
- Type in the following, then press Enter:
exit
- Type in the following, then press Enter:
mysql -uivsadmin -p valt < valt.sql
- Enter the password for MySQL.
- Type in the following, then press Enter:
mysql -uivsadmin -p valt -e "UPDATE wowza SET address = 'NewServerIP'"
- Enter the password for MySQL.